One of the science fiction universes that I've held in high regard for perhaps the longest time would be the Battletech/Mechwarrior universe. The entire series takes place in the 31st century (disregarding the Dark Age universe for the moment), in which humanity has colonized almost 1000 worlds. These worlds are controlled by 1 of 5 great houses, who continuously fight one another for control of the galaxy.

Their weapons of war are massive 2 to 3 story tall war machines known as Battlemechs. Battlemechs are basically walking tanks, either bipedal or quadrepedal, armed with enough weaponry to take down a city block by themselves.

The universe has the usual trappings of science fiction. Mercenaries, nobles, bandits, etc. but it also had The Clans; decendants of a group of humans who left the known universe in the 28th century. They have technology rivaling those in the Inner Sphere (where the great houses are)

Machinima is the term given to the method of making a movie utilizing a video game's engine and technology.
